Abstract

A deposition of bubbles or foams to an inner wall of a liquid supplying member is prevented, thereby improving ejecting performance of the bubbles or foams. In the liquid supplying member which forms a flow path for supplying a liquid to a liquid discharging apparatus, the inner wall surface has a concave/convex shape in which a mountain portion and a valley portion are repeated at a predetermined spatial frequency. Assuming that an opening diameter of a filter provided for the liquid discharging apparatus is equal to R (μm), one period f (μm)of the spatial frequency lies within a range from R or more to √{square root over (2)}·R or less and a maximum height Ry (μm) of the mountain portion is equal to √{square root over (2)}·R/2 or more.
